| Definition of 'Ragwort' |
Princeton's WordNet |
|
1. (noun) ragwort, tansy ragwort, ragweed, benweed, Senecio jacobaea
widespread European weed having yellow daisylike flowers; sometimes an obnoxious weed and toxic to cattle if consumed in quantity
2. (noun) butterweed, ragwort, Senecio glabellus
American ragwort with yellow flowers
